## TICKET-4471: Snapshot config drift between CI and local runs

Context for the new contractor: snapshot tests for the Larkspur component library keep failing in CI but passing locally. Root cause is configuration drift — the renderer options in CI diverged from the checked-in config about three weeks ago, so font metrics and viewport sizes differ. Fix is to make CI read the committed config verbatim and delete the ad-hoc overrides. The canonical snapshot renderer settings are as follows.

config for bawig-fadup:
[zorix]
host = zorix.lumicworks.corp
user = zorix_svc
database = zorix_prod

Q2 Planning Note — Sunsetting the Ferrow Classic Line

Sales leads, heads up: we're retiring the Ferrow Classic line by year-end. Margins have been thin for three quarters, and the Ferrow Apex covers the same use cases better. Plan your pipelines accordingly — no new Classic quotes after June, existing orders honored through December. We'll have trade-up incentives ready by May, so don't panic about open accounts. Spare parts support continues for two years. The reasoning behind the timing connects to a bigger picture, outlined below.

board note of tadup-tajog: Headcount on the Oliiel team goes from 31 to 88 by the end of February. Gross margin on Oliiel came in at 62 percent against a plan of 29 percent.

# Break-Glass: Catalog Cache Invalidation

Scope: the Pinrow product catalog at Veldstone Retail. If stale prices persist after a purge and the Hollowmere invalidation queue is wedged, use break-glass to flush the edge tier directly. Contractors: get verbal sign-off from the catalog lead first. Steps: open the Hollowmere admin shell, select emergency-flush, confirm the tenant, and run it once — repeated flushes thrash the origin. Access is logged and expires after 20 minutes. Unseal the admin shell with the passphrase below.

recovery phrase for kahop-tajog: istix-casvan